Frosinone, nestled in the green heart of Lazio, Italy, is a city that vibrates with history and art. Its cultural heritage is expressed through museums such as the National Archaeological Museum, which houses Etruscan and Roman artifacts, narrating ancient civilizations. Contemporary art galleries, like the Civic Gallery of Modern and Contemporary Art, offer a glimpse into local and international artistic talent, with works that challenge the imagination.
Iconic monuments like the Cathedral of Santa Maria Assunta stand as witnesses to Frosinone's medieval past, with frescoes and sculptures that tell stories of faith and beauty. Strolling through the streets, one discovers picturesque corners and architectures that blend styles, from Romanesque to Baroque, creating an urban fabric rich in charm.
